In this episode, Rob recounts to Buddy and Sally how his honeymoon with Laura was a complete disaster. What follows is a lengthy flashback to Rob during his Army days. It seems that after Rob finally got out of the hospital (where he spent his wedding day and several days past it due to an illness), he's ready to use his 3-day pass for a honeymoon. However, his commanding officer is a jerk (much like Captain Queeg from "The Caine Mutiny") and has canceled all leaves due to a theft of some wine. This doesn't make any sense and seems cruel--especially since he won't make an exception for Rob. So, there's only one thing Rob has left to do...to sneak off the base and go AWOL. Of course, things don't go as planned and motel turns out to be a dump....and you'll have to see all that for yourself.
This is a very funny episode and it's a nice follow-up to "The Attempted Marriage" from season two. It's full of laughs and has a nice series of twists at the end. And, as one reviewer pointed out, it's made better by a lovely performance by Kathleen Freeman.
